Cancer Alliance Stigma Survey

Cancer stigma is a great problem in South Africa, it touches all groups, ages and genders and impacts cancer patients daily.

With our current survey we aim to gain more information and insight into the role of cancer stigma in our communities.

What Are Egg Bites?

Starbucks egg bites are a product that features sous vide-cooked eggs, which are blended with various ingredients such as cheese, resulting in a soft, custard-like texture. Unlike traditional omelets, egg bites are prepared using a sous vide method, which involves cooking the eggs at a precise temperature to achieve consistency and doneness.

Each serving typically contains two bites, making them suitable for consumption both on the go and in a dining setting.

The range of flavors includes options such as bacon, egg white, and cheese, each containing a significant amount of protein. This format caters to those seeking a protein-rich, convenient meal option that can be consumed quickly, often within a few minutes.

For optimal enjoyment, it is recommended to serve the egg bites warm and season them with pepper or other condiments according to personal preference.

Overall, the product's design and cooking method contribute to its appeal among consumers looking for quick, nutritious meal solutions.

Starbucks Egg Bites: Flavors and Nutrition

Starbucks offers a selection of Egg Bites that includes three flavors designed to accommodate various preferences and dietary considerations. The available options are Bacon & Gruyère, Kale & Mushroom, and Egg White & Roasted Red Pepper.

Each flavor contains a significant amount of protein, ranging from 12 grams to 19 grams per serving, making them a viable choice for those seeking a high-protein snack or meal. Among these options, the Kale & Mushroom flavor has the lowest sodium content, which may be preferable for individuals monitoring their sodium intake.

The Egg Bites are prepared using the sous vide method, resulting in a consistent, custard-like texture that is easy to consume. They can be readily heated and enjoyed without the need for further cooking equipment, simplifying the preparation process.

Costco Egg Bites: Options and Value

In 2023, Costco introduced a range of egg bites to diversify its breakfast and snack options. The product features two flavors: Bacon & Gruyère and Egg White & Roasted Red Pepper. Each serving is prepared to a texture that resembles a tender omelet and can be reheated easily in either a pan or microwave.

Nutritionally, the Bacon & Gruyère variant contains 17 grams of protein, while the Egg White & Roasted Red Pepper variety offers 11 grams of protein per serving. This protein content makes them a substantial choice for those seeking high-protein meals or snacks.

These egg bites can be consumed in various ways; they can be placed on a plate for a sit-down meal, eaten on the go, or paired with traditional breakfast items.

Price-wise, Costco positions these egg bites as a more economical option compared to similar offerings from Starbucks, which enhances their appeal to budget-conscious consumers looking for convenient meal solutions.

Comparing Starbucks and Costco Egg Bites

When comparing the nutritional profiles of Starbucks and Costco Egg Bites, several notable differences in protein and sodium content emerge.

Starbucks generally provides a higher protein content per serving, particularly exemplified by its Bacon & Gruyère variety, which contains 19 grams of protein compared to 17 grams in Costco's equivalent. However, it is important to note that Starbucks also has a higher sodium content and is significantly more expensive per serving.

This trend continues with the Egg White & Roasted Red Pepper variety, where Starbucks offers slightly more protein as well. Yet, Costco's pricing remains more favorable.

Therefore, when considering your options, it is advisable to evaluate how much protein is necessary for your dietary needs relative to the cost and sodium content of each choice. This analytical approach will help inform a decision that aligns with your nutritional preferences and budget.

Ingredients and Preparation Methods

An examination of the ingredients and preparation methods highlights the unique attributes of Starbucks Egg Bites. These bites are composed of eggs, cheese, and various fillings such as bacon or roasted red pepper.

The preparation method employed by Starbucks is sous vide, which involves cooking the egg mixture at controlled temperatures for an extended period. This technique results in a creamy texture that distinguishes them from traditionally pan-cooked omelets.

Each serving of Egg Bites is a significant source of protein, particularly the Bacon & Gruyère variety. The culinary approach allows for flexibility in consumption; they can be enjoyed hot or at room temperature without compromising their intended consistency.

Whether made with egg whites or whole eggs, the preparation ensures that the bites maintain a moist texture, contributing to their overall appeal. This methodical approach to ingredients and cooking reinforces the reliability of Starbucks Egg Bites as a consistent and satisfying option.

Suggested Pairings and Meal Planning

Pairing egg bites with complementary sides can effectively enhance their nutritional value and transform them into a balanced meal. For instance, consuming Starbucks Egg Bites, such as the Bacon & Gruyère variety, alongside whole grain toast can contribute to a protein-rich breakfast. The addition of sliced avocado or a light salsa not only complements the dish but also provides healthy fats and flavors without significantly increasing sodium content.

For those with more time, an alternative preparation method involves cooking oats in a pan and incorporating eggs, akin to making an omelet, which increases the overall protein content of the meal.

At the table, seasoning with pepper or including a serving of fruit can offer additional vitamins and minerals, contributing to a more nutrient-dense meal.

It is also worth noting that preparing individual servings in advance allows for effective meal planning, ensuring a well-rounded breakfast option that can easily fit into various dietary schedules.

This approach promotes convenience while maintaining nutritional integrity.
